Höyrypölynhaittoja is a Finnish term used to describe harms arising from the interaction of steam and dust in industrial environments. The presence of moisture-laden dust can cause particles to stick, form agglomerates, and deposit on surfaces and equipment, while steam can transport and redistribute these particles, potentially creating localized concentration peaks and hygiene challenges.
